Ghayas, of Arabic origin, means 'cry' or 'call for help', often symbolizing a leader or protector who responds to the needs of others. It carries a strong, courageous connotation, reflecting someone who takes action in times of crisis. The name is culturally significant in Arabic-speaking regions, embodying strength and responsibility.
